Abstract:
      A new method for the determination of Nb, Sn, Fe and Cr in N18 alloy by inductively coupled plasma atomic emission spectrometry was established. Analytical conditions such as preparations of sample solutions, the matrix interference and the analytical lines selection, etc, were discussed. The interferences were eliminated by using the matrix matching method and the experimental conditions were optimized. The proposed method has been applied to determine the contents of Nb, Sn, Fe and Cr in N18 alloy, and the determination results were consistent with those obtained by chemical analysis method. The recovery was 96.7%~101.0%, and the relative standard deviation (RSD, n=11) were less than 3.0 %.
